Storyboarding

Storyboarding is really important for planning the opening to your film sequence. 

Read through the storyboarding information slide below. 

Task:

Watch a film opening (of your choice) and identify the 6 most important shots. Draw a stoyboard of these shots, annotating for:

- Genre Signifiers
- Mise-en-scene
- Camera
- Editing
- Sound 

Ensure it is drawn, coloured in etc (colour is also important!)

Once finished, take a photo of your storyboard and upload to your blog, including a reflection of this task.
